Voltage and Power Outlets in Egypt: Everything You Need to Know Before Your Trip
If you're planning to travel to Egypt, it's important to understand how the country's electrical system works to avoid any unexpected issues during your trip. The standard voltage in Egypt is... 220 voltios (V)....which is different from many Latin American countries, where 110 volts (V) is still commonly used. 110 VBefore plugging in your smartphone, laptop, camera, or any other electronic device, make sure it supports dual voltage (100–240 V). If your device only operates on 110 V, you will need to use a suitable voltage converter (transformer) to avoid damaging it.
Another important detail is the type of power outlets used in Egypt. Most hotels, apartments, and other establishments use Type C and Type F power outlets, which feature two round-pin sockets. two-round-pin power outlets (Type C and Type F)...similar to those found in many European countries. For this reason, it is recommended to bring a universal travel adapter, especially if your devices use a different plug type. This small accessory makes it easy to charge your electronic devices and helps you avoid unnecessary inconvenience during your trip.
